What is crochet?

Kroshe — is a technique for creating fabric by interweaving loops of yarn using a special hook.

The name of the term comes from the French word crochet , which translates as "hook." In the context of fashion, answering the question "what is crochet style?" is a movement that includes clothing and accessories with a distinctive, openwork, woven texture, evoking handcrafted and bohemian aesthetics.

Historically, this technique originated as a home craft. In the 1970s, it became a symbol of freedom and hippie culture, and in modern fashion, it has transformed into a regular summer trend and an essential element of cruise collections. Designers integrate crochet into their ready-to-wear lines, creating both lightweight beachwear and sophisticated urban silhouettes.

Distinctive features

The main characteristic of crochet is its openwork structure with perforations and distinct patterns. The most popular element is the granny square, as well as various floral motifs and geometric grids.

Crocheted fabric is denser, more textured, and three-dimensional than traditional machine-knitted fabric. Even when factory-made, items made using this technique visually imitate artisanal labor and a personal touch.

Traditionally, natural threads such as cotton, linen, or wool are used for weaving. In modern interpretations, brands use metallic yarn, raffia, or blended fibers, which allow the garments to better retain their shape and prevent stretching with wear.

What to combine with

Crochet styling is based on a play of contrasting textures. Lace tops, vests, or cardigans are paired with smooth, dense materials—classic denim, matte leather, silk, or satin.

Sheer dresses and tunics require layering. They're worn over thick, basic slip dresses, tank tops, or, for resort looks, over swimsuits.

Structured pieces, such as polo shirts or cropped vests, are used to integrate into an urban wardrobe. These pieces are worn with wide-leg, pleated suit trousers or straight-leg jeans, complementing the outfit with leather loafers or minimalist sneakers.

Accent accessories like shopper bags, bucket hats, and scarves act as standalone textured details. They complement simple casual looks of basic T-shirts and denim, adding a bohemian, relaxed edge.
